Unreal Engine 4 (UE4) — это мощный инструмент для создания игр и визуализации проектов. Одним из ключевых элементов в разработке игр является анимация персонажей, которая придает им жизненность и реалистичность. В этой статье мы расскажем вам, как изменить анимацию в UE4 и поделимся советами, которые помогут вам создать потрясающие анимационные эффекты.
Перед тем, как приступить к созданию или изменению анимации в UE4, важно иметь представление о базовых принципах анимации и уметь работать с анимационным редактором. UE4 предоставляет широкий набор возможностей для создания и редактирования анимаций, включая возможность импорта анимаций из внешних программ.
Одним из главных инструментов для изменения анимации в UE4 является «Animation Blueprint». Он позволяет создавать сложные логические схемы для управления анимацией персонажа. В «Animation Blueprint» вы можете задать различные условия и переходы между анимациями в зависимости от действий игрока или других факторов.
Подготовка проекта к работе с анимацией
Прежде чем приступить к созданию и изменению анимаций в Unreal Engine 4 (UE4), необходимо правильно подготовить проект. Это поможет упростить и ускорить работу с анимациями, а также предоставит вам больше возможностей для их создания и редактирования.
Вот несколько важных шагов, которые следует выполнить:
1. Импортирование скелета
Прежде чем создавать анимации, вам потребуется скелет – структура кости, определяющая анатомию персонажа или объекта. В UE4 скелеты создаются в программе 3D-моделирования (например, Maya или Blender) и импортируются в проект. Убедитесь, что импортируемый скелет соответствует вашим требованиям и настройкам проекта.
2. Создание или импорт анимаций
После импорта скелета можно приступить к созданию или импорту анимаций. Вы можете создавать анимации прямо в UE4 с помощью инструментов анимации, таких как Persona. Также вы можете импортировать анимации, созданные в других программам, таких как MotionBuilder или 3ds Max. Важно, чтобы анимации были в совместимом формате и соответствовали требованиям проекта.
3. Настройка анимационной системы
UE4 предлагает широкие возможности настройки и редактирования анимаций. Вы можете определить различные состояния и переходы между ними, изменять параметры анимации (например, скорость, сила или направление движения), добавлять анимационные блоки и смешивать различные анимации. Важно уделить время настройке анимационной системы, чтобы получить желаемый результат.
4. Тестирование и отладка анимаций
После создания и настройки анимаций важно протестировать их в игровом процессе. Запустите проект, чтобы увидеть, как анимации работают в реальном времени. Возможно, вам придется внести дополнительные правки или исправления, чтобы улучшить результат. Кроме того, не забывайте о возможности отладки анимаций, чтобы выявить и исправить возможные ошибки или проблемы.
Следуя этим шагам, вы сможете подготовить свой проект к работе с анимацией в UE4 и создавать реалистичные и потрясающие анимации для своих игр и приложений.
Создание анимационных ресурсов
Первым способом создания анимаций является использование встроенных анимационных инструментов в Unreal Engine 4, таких как Animation Blueprint. Animation Blueprint позволяет создавать сложные анимации путем соединения различных анимационных узлов и устанавливать параметры для контроля анимации. Вы можете создавать анимации как для персонажей, так и для объектов в окружении игры.
Вторым способом создания анимаций является импорт готовых анимационных файлов, созданных в других программных средах, таких как 3Ds Max или Maya. Вы можете импортировать анимационные файлы в форматах FBX или Alembic и использовать их в Unreal Engine 4. При импорте вы можете настроить параметры анимации и присвоить их вашим персонажам или объектам.
Третий способ создания анимаций в Unreal Engine 4 — это использование средств математической анимации. Вы можете использовать математические функции и уравнения для создания различных анимаций, таких как движение персонажа или эффекты окружения. Этот метод требует хороших знаний математики, но позволяет создавать уникальные и сложные анимации для вашей игры.
Важно помнить, что создание анимаций — это процесс, требующий времени и терпения. Однако Unreal Engine 4 предоставляет вам все необходимые инструменты и возможности для создания профессиональных анимаций для вашего проекта.
Использование существующих анимаций
В Unreal Engine 4 вы можете использовать существующие анимации для своих персонажей или объектов. Это позволяет сэкономить время и усилия на создание новых анимаций и сосредоточиться на других аспектах проекта.
Для использования существующих анимаций вам потребуется импортировать их в Unreal Engine 4. Сначала вам нужно найти нужные анимации, которые могут быть доступны в виде отдельных файлов или как часть набора анимаций или моделей. Затем вы можете импортировать их в формате .fbx или .obj с помощью инструментов импорта Unreal Engine.
После импорта анимаций вы можете просмотреть их в редакторе анимаций Unreal Engine и настроить события, состояния и переходы, чтобы анимации соответствовали вашим потребностям. Вы можете также использовать Blueprint-скрипты для управления анимациями в игре.
Unreal Engine 4 предлагает множество инструментов для настройки и изменения существующих анимаций. Вы можете изменять скорость анимации, перемещать и поворачивать кости и объекты, применять эффекты и фильтры к анимациям, добавлять звуки и многое другое.
Использование существующих анимаций в Unreal Engine 4 может быть полезным способом улучшить визуальные эффекты и игровой процесс вашего проекта. Отличной возможностью является использование анимаций от других разработчиков или инди-студий, чтобы ускорить разработку игры и добавить профессиональный вид вашему проекту.
Преимущества использования существующих анимаций: |
---|
Экономия времени и ресурсов на создание новых анимаций. |
Возможность использовать профессиональные анимации от других разработчиков. |
Увеличение визуального качества игры. |
Расширение возможностей анимаций с помощью настроек и фильтров. |
Улучшение игрового процесса с помощью реалистичных движений. |
Редактирование и настройка анимаций
В Unreal Engine 4 существует несколько способов редактирования и настройки анимаций. Один из них — использование встроенного визуального редактора анимаций. С его помощью можно создавать и изменять анимационные состояния и переходы между ними.
Для начала работы с редактором анимаций необходимо импортировать анимационные файлы в форматах FBX или Alembic. Затем можно создавать новые анимационные состояния и добавлять переходы между ними.
Действие | Описание |
---|---|
Переименование | Изменение названия состояния или перехода для удобства организации анимаций. |
Настройка параметров | Изменение параметров состояния или перехода, таких как скорость воспроизведения, петли и прочее. |
Установка событий | Добавление событий, которые могут быть использованы для запуска звуковых эффектов или других действий в игре. |
Редактирование ключевых кадров | Изменение позы или положения персонажа или объекта в конкретном кадре анимации. |
Кроме этого, Unreal Engine 4 поддерживает такие особенности, как скелетная анимация, сокращение блоков анимации, смешивание анимаций и другие, которые позволяют создавать более сложные и реалистичные движения.
Редактирование и настройка анимаций в Unreal Engine 4 — важный шаг в разработке игры. Это позволяет создать уникальный и реалистичный игровой опыт для игроков.
Применение анимаций к персонажу
Для создания реалистичного и живого персонажа в игре важно применить анимации, которые будут передавать его движения, эмоции и поведение. Unreal Engine 4 предоставляет мощные инструменты и возможности для работы с анимациями, которые позволяют создавать высококачественные и плавные переходы между движениями персонажа.
Чтобы применить анимации к персонажу, необходимо выполнить несколько шагов:
- Создание или импорт анимаций. В Unreal Engine 4 можно создавать анимации с нуля, используя встроенные инструменты, либо импортировать готовые анимации из специализированных программных средств.
- Создание анимационного компонента. Для применения анимаций к персонажу необходимо создать анимационный компонент, который будет отвечать за управление анимациями и передвижениями персонажа.
- Привязка анимаций к персонажу. После создания анимационного компонента необходимо привязать анимации к персонажу. Для этого используются различные триггеры и условия, которые определяют, когда и какая анимация должна быть проиграна.
Кроме того, Unreal Engine 4 предоставляет возможность редактирования и настройки анимаций, что позволяет добиться их максимальной реалистичности и соответствия заданным параметрам. Также с помощью Blueprint можно создавать сложные системы переходов между анимациями, управлять поворотами и перемещением персонажа в пространстве и многое другое.
Применение анимаций к персонажу является важным этапом разработки игры, который позволяет создать неповторимый и уникальный опыт для игрока. С помощью Unreal Engine 4 и его инструментов анимирование персонажа становится простым и достижимым задачей для разработчиков игр.
Добавление звуковых эффектов и музыки
Сначала необходимо подготовить аудиофайлы, которые вы хотите использовать в игре. Вы можете найти готовые звуковые библиотеки или создать свои собственные звуковые эффекты и музыку. Важно помнить, что права на использование и распространение аудиофайлов должны быть законными.
После подготовки аудиофайлов вы можете добавить их в Unreal Engine 4. В браузере контента выберите папку, куда вы хотите добавить аудиофайлы, и щелкните правой кнопкой мыши. Затем выберите «Import» (Импорт) и выберите нужные аудиофайлы. Unreal Engine 4 поддерживает различные форматы аудио, включая WAV, MP3 и OGG.
После импорта аудиофайлов вы можете использовать их в вашем проекте. Вы можете добавить звуковые эффекты к определенным действиям или объектам в игре. Например, при взаимодействии с дверью вы можете воспроизводить звук открывания или закрывания. Для этого необходимо создать анимацию и привязать к ней звуковые эффекты.
Также вы можете добавить фоновую музыку к вашему проекту. Фоновая музыка может создать атмосферу и поддерживать настроение игрока. Вы можете добавить музыку в определенные сцены или уровни игры. Для этого создайте новую звуковую дорожку (Sound Cue) и добавьте на нее аудиофайл с музыкой.
Добавление звуковых эффектов и музыки в Unreal Engine 4 поможет вам создать более реалистичный и захватывающий игровой мир. Используйте свою фантазию и экспериментируйте с различными звуковыми эффектами и музыкой, чтобы сделать вашу игру уникальной и незабываемой.
Экспорт и импорт анимаций в UE4
В Unreal Engine 4 (UE4) существуют различные методы экспорта и импорта анимаций для работы с анимационными данными вне движка. Это может быть полезно, например, при совместной работе с командой аниматоров или использовании сторонних программ для создания анимаций.
Для экспорта анимаций из UE4 можно воспользоваться системой экспорта Fbx (Filmbox). Для этого необходимо выбрать нужный скелет, затем открыть окно «Persona», в котором находятся все анимационные ресурсы, и выбрать необходимую анимацию. Далее следует нажать правой кнопкой мыши на выбранную анимацию и выбрать в контекстном меню пункт «Экспортировать». В появившемся окне необходимо указать имя файла и путь сохранения. После этого можно выбрать необходимые опции экспорта, такие как формат файла, координатную систему и другие. После нажатия на кнопку «Экспортировать» выбранная анимация будет сохранена в указанном месте в нужном формате (например, .fbx).
Чтобы импортировать анимацию в UE4, необходимо выбрать нужный скелет и открыть окно «Persona». Далее нужно нажать на кнопку «Импорт» и выбрать файл с анимацией. В появившемся окне импорта можно выбрать необходимые опции, такие как формат файла, координатную систему и другие. После нажатия на кнопку «Импортировать» анимация будет добавлена в список доступных анимаций.
Важно учесть, что при экспорте и импорте анимаций в UE4 следует соблюдать определенные требования к форматам и настройкам файлов. Например, скелет должен быть совместим с форматом экспорта/импорта, а имена костей должны совпадать. Также необходимо учитывать, что некоторые анимационные эффекты, такие как физическая симуляция, могут быть потеряны при экспорте и импорте.
Использование экспорта и импорта анимаций в UE4 позволяет эффективно работать с анимационными данными, обмениваться ими с коллегами и использовать сторонние программы для создания качественных анимаций.